Real plotting nostalgic Ozil return
Those pesky transfer chiefs at La Liga giants Real Madrid are stealing the headlines yet again this Sunday morning, as reports continue to suggest the Spanish big-guns are tired of shiny new toy James Rodriguez and will flog the Colombian this summer.
Though, the twist in this tale is that Los Blancos do not want to trade their current star up for a newer model, but could instead return to raid Arsenal for former flame Mesut Ozil. The inconsistent but brilliant German playmaker bid goodbye to the Bernabeau back in 2013, for a fee believed to be around £42.4m, and now the Madrid men may try to undo their costly mistake.

Everton eyeing English replacement for Stones
Catalan coach Roberto Martinez knows a ball-playing centre back when he sees one and could also plunder Arsenal (12/5 with Coral to lift the Premier League) for squad player and defender Calum Chambers, should coveted John Stones eventually be plucked away from Goodison Park.
Just like the current Toffees fan favourite, Southampton academy graduate Chambers can be deployed as a centre half or right back and is handy with the ball at his feet, making him an ideal replacement. Hurrah! A transfer rumour which seems entirely plausible, perhaps.

City star in midfield gossip
Manchester City look set to restructure their midfield by injecting some fresh legs into the Etihad roster, with one midfield exit and an entrance the latest gossip to arrive from Mancunia.
The Sky Blues (5/4 favourites for the Premier League) may allow engine room fixture Yaya Toure to finally pack his bags and head to the Orient with Chinese club Shanghai SIPG, though PSV Eindhoven’s 20-year-old Uruguayan attacking midfielder Gaston Pereiro could be brought in to add a little dynamism and make up the numbers.
While, if either the blue or red side of Manchester snap up Pep Guardiola this summer, Bayern Munich have currently unemployed coach Carlo Ancelotti in mind as a back-up boss, should their attempts to sway Guardiola to stay fail.

Staying across town at Old Trafford, after a poor week of results from Manchester United, down in the dumps Red Devils fans could well be heartened to hear the Premier League giants are tracking another teenage striking sensation from France.
United’s last transfer from across the channel has certainly impressed so far and, should PSG’s 17-year-old forward Odsonne Edouard snub a new contract from the Ligue 1 club, Man Utd are reportedly ready to make an offer for the starlet.
